Ta Frenc Petshop Siggiewi
Blat Il Qamar Road, Is-Siggiewi
A
Find Pet Stores in Is-Siggiewi. Listings include Ta Frenc Petshop Siggiewi and Ta frenc petshop. Click on each in the list below the map for more information.